Road Bike Or Mountain Bike For City. While road bikes are suitable only for paved roads, mountain bikes are versatile thanks to wider tires and suspension. Road bikes are designed for speed and efficiency on paved roads, while city bikes are built for comfort and versatility in an urban environment. Road bikes excel in speed and efficiency on smooth roads, while mountain bikes are built for rough terrain, each offering. We’ll compare weight, efficiency, handling, durability, versatility, cost, and more. This guide lists the pros and cons of riding a mountain bike vs road bike. Riding style do you prefer a more aggressive riding position for speed and control or a more upright riding position for comfort and visibility? While you can certainly ride a mountain bike on paved surfaces, you really can't take a road bike off the pavement.
